Dispatchers get hands-on look at active shootings

9-1-1 in the Classroom, Training | | July 14, 2009 at 1:50 pm

beaumont_leadDispatchers in Beaumont, Texas were inspired by PowerPhone’s Active Shooting Response course to take their training a step further.

George Deuchar, PowerPhone’s Director of Training, conducted two Active Shooting Response training programs for the Beaumont 9-1-1 Operations Center in May. During the programs, George emphasized the need for dispatchers to see active shootings from “the other side” by understanding what responders go through and how they prepare to handle such incidents.

Carolyn Lewis, Beaumont’s 9-1-1 Center Training/QA Supervisor, agreed. After obtaining permission from the Chief of Police, Beaumont’s dispatchers had the opportunity to suit up in gear and go through an active shooting simulation. Carolyn was kind enough to share some photos of the training with us.
